August 99, 2095 <br />Under sealed bid procedures, as a matter of responsiveness, or with initial <br />proposals, under contract negotiation procedures; <br />Administrative reconsideration (26.53(d <br />Within 2 business days of being informed by the County of Kittitas that it is not <br />responsive because it has not documented sufficient good faith efforts, a bidder/offeror <br />may request administrative reconsideration. Bidder/offerors should make this request in <br />writing to the following reconsideration official: <br />Candie Leader <br />411 N Ruby St <br />Suite 1 <br />Ellensburg, WA 98926 <br />(509) 962-7699 <br />candie.leader co.kittitas.wa.us <br />The reconsideration official will not have played any role in the original determination <br />that the bidderlofferor did not document sufficient good faith efforts. <br />As part of this reconsideration, the bidder/offeror will have the opportunity to provide <br />written documentation or argument concerning the issue of whether it met the goal or <br />made adequate good faith efforts to do so. The bidder/offeror will have the opportunity <br />to meet in person with our reconsideration official to discuss the issue of whether it met <br />the goal or made adequate good faith efforts to do. We will send the bidder/offeror a <br />written decision on reconsideration, explaining the basis for finding that the bidder did or <br />did not meet the goal or make adequate good faith efforts to do so. The result of the <br />reconsideration process is not administratively appealable to the Department of <br />Transportation. <br />Good Faith Efforts procedures in situations when there are contract goals (26.53(ng) <br />We will include in each prime contract a provision stating: <br />The contractor shall utilize the specific DBEs listed to perform the work and <br />supply the materials for which each is listed unless the contractor obtains your <br />written consent as provided in this paragraph 26.53(f); and <br />That, unless our consent is provided under this paragraph 26.53(f), the contractor <br />shall not be entitled to any payment for work or material unless it is performed or <br />supplied by the listed DBE. <br />We will require the contractor that is awarded the contract to make available upon <br />request a copy of all DBE subcontracts.
